Pride and Passion: The African-American Baseball Experience

June 20, 2012August 3, 2012

This nationally travelling exhibit examines the challenges faced by African-American baseball players as they sought equal opportunities in their sport beginning in the post-Civil War era, through integration of the major leagues in the mid-20th century. The Library's show also includes a number of artifacts from the Louisville Slugger Museum's collection.

"Pride and Passion" was organized by the National Baseball Hall of Fame and Museum and the American Library Association Public Programs Office, and was made possible by a major grant from the National Endowment for the Humanities.
